If you are absolutely sure that you have a fresh install of EQ Titanium (not Trilogy or any other version), then most likely your issue is with a multi-core CPU if you have one. The FAQ in my sig has some suggestions to correct that issue.

But, if you have had any other version of EQ installed on your PC before you installed Titanium to use with the emulator, then most likely that is the cause of your issue. You will want to completely remove all other versions of EQ from your PC, and delete the directories they were in completely. Then, reinstall Titanium again. Also, make 100% certain that you don't patch even for a second. Any patching at all will cause that exact issue.

It is possible to have multiple versions of EQ on the same PC, but you have to have them loaded into their own separate directories. Installing Titanium over an existing EQ directory will normally cause issues. Also, EQ Trilogy has been known to cause similar issues even if it is installed in a separate directory. I would recommend removing that from your PC completely if you have it installed. I think it might have something to do with it being a trial version of the game and it is a special build. Maybe that causes problems with retail installations.

Also, if the version of Titanium you have was from a download or anything other than directly from the CDs, then you have the wrong version. Right now, the only acceptable versions are the retail releases of EQ Titanium and Secrets of Faydwer is also available on some servers (it is still in the final stages of development for EQEmu).
